Output 62506d90237e7e3eda2ce22944e5f378ae97f8d786a23302a6e0c011fc495b80:0

value
36422745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cfb5bf4be79856db7947d84d1cf942eaa05416f5 OP_EQUALVERIFY OP_CHECKSIG
address
LeADrwcMVyxURovqNQLsEhKRxp14SdBkA2
transaction
62506d90237e7e3eda2ce22944e5f378ae97f8d786a23302a6e0c011fc495b80
spent
true